Damian is paid $1,980 monthly. What is his annual salary?

Mathematics
2 answers:
soldi70 [24.7K]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

$23,760

Step-by-step explanation:

We have been given that Damian is paid $1,980 monthly. We are asked to find Damian's annual salary.

We know that 1 year equals 12 months, so to find Damian annual salary, we will multiply monthly salary by 12:

\text{ Damian's annual salary}=\$1,980\times 12

\text{ Damian's annual salary}=\$23,760

Therefore, Damian's annual salary would be $23,760 and option B is the correct choice.

Why is this number not in scientific<br> notation?<br> 36.5 x 10^6<br> please help
andrew11 [14]

Answer:

The first number should be a number between 1 and 10 (see explanation)

Step-by-step explanation:

For a number to be in scientific notation, a number between 1 and 10 has to be multiplied by a power of 10.

36.5 is not between 1 and 10, alternatively, you can rearrange it:

3.65 x 10^7      <----This would be the correct scientific notation
